When you're Mark Wahlberg and you have a garage full of cars including Bentley's, Mercedes' and Porsche's you certainly can't add a plain jane stock Escalade to the mix. Mark recently brought his Cadillac down to the guys at West Coast Customs for a little overhaul (OK, a big overhaul). The interior was completely stripped so that an automated partition could be added as well as ergonomic recliner seats, a DirecTV satellite link with LCD monitors and retracting table-tops (for when Mark needs to do a little business from the backseat). Of course the outside needed a little something too so they blacked it out and added new wheels and suspension.
Olympic medalist Apolo Ohno recently sat down to talk with our friend Brett Berk from Vanity Fair about his latest project -- a "burgundylicious" custom 1964 Cadillac convertible. The Cadillac is custom built by Kindig-It Design with a monster 502-cubic-inch V-8, a deep burgundylicious paint job, massive chrome wheels that imitate wide whitewall tires, and a white leather interior with a gauge cluster shaped like the Olympic five-ring icon (of course).
During the interview Apolo also mentions that he has a 2011 BMW 7-Series for his daily driver and that he just recently sold a lot of his other cars because he's been traveling so much. He's definitely a car guy though and says that he's already looking at a new sports car like the Ferrari 458 Spider or the Lamborghini Aventador Spyder (we'll let you know when he does). He also just bought his father a Black-Edition Nissan GT-R...talk about a nice guy!
